The independent report into the devastating floods in Laxey last October will be a subject of discussion in Tynwald tomorrow.
Garff MHK Martyn Perkins will ask Chief Minister, Howard Quayle MHK, when the evaluation by independent consultants ARUP will be published.
The severe weather in Laxey on October 1, 2019, caused widespread damage in the area to homes and businesses and sparked a major emergency operation to help residents.
The court is due to convene at Legislative Buildings in Douglas on Tuesday from 10.30am.
